+package java.io;
+
+// NOTE: This implementation is very similar to that of PipedOutputStream.
+// If you fix a bug in here, chances are you should make a similar change to
+// the PipedOutputStream code.
+
+/**
+ * This class writes its chars to a <code>PipedReader</code> to
+ * which it is connected.
+ * <p>
+ * It is highly recommended that a <code>PipedWriter</code> and its
+ * connected <code>PipedReader</code> be in different threads. If
+ * they are in the same thread, read and write operations could deadlock
+ * the thread.
+ *
+ * @author Aaron M. Renn (arenn@urbanophile.com)
+ */
+public class PipedWriter extends Writer
+{
+ /** Target PipedReader to which this is connected. Null only if this
+ * Writer hasn't been connected yet. */
+ PipedReader sink;
+
+ /** Set to true if close() has been called on this Writer. */
+ boolean closed;
+
+ /** Buffer used to implement single-argument write */
+ char[] read_buf = new char[1];
+
+ /**
+ * Create an unconnected PipedWriter. It must be connected
+ * to a <code>PipedReader</code> using the <code>connect</code>
+ * method prior to writing any data or an exception will be thrown.
+ */
+ public PipedWriter()
+ {
+ }
+
+ /**
+ * Create a new <code>PipedWriter</code> instance
+ * to write to the specified <code>PipedReader</code>. This stream
+ * is then ready for writing.
+ *
+ * @param sink The <code>PipedReader</code> to connect this stream to.
+ *
+ * @exception IOException If <code>sink</code> has already been connected
+ * to a different PipedWriter.
+ */
+ public PipedWriter(PipedReader sink) throws IOException
+ {
+ sink.connect(this);
+ }
+
+ /**
+ * Connects this object to the specified <code>PipedReader</code>
+ * object. This stream will then be ready for writing.
+ *
+ * @param sink The <code>PipedReader</code> to connect this stream to
+ *
+ * @exception IOException If the stream has not been connected or has
+ * been closed.
+ */
+ public void connect(PipedReader sink) throws IOException
+ {
+ if (this.sink != null || sink.source != null)
+ throw new IOException ("Already connected");
+ sink.connect(this);
+ }
+
+ /**
+ * Write a single char of date to the stream. Note that this method will
+ * block if the <code>PipedReader</code> to which this object is
+ * connected has a full buffer.
+ *
+ * @param b The char of data to be written, passed as an <code>int</code>.
+ *
+ * @exception IOException If the stream has not been connected or has
+ * been closed.
+ */
+ public void write(int b) throws IOException
+ {
+ read_buf[0] = (char) (b & 0xffff);
+ sink.receive (read_buf, 0, 1);
+ }
+
+ /**
+ * This method writes <code>len</code> chars of data from the char array
+ * <code>buf</code> starting at index <code>offset</code> in the array
+ * to the stream. Note that this method will block if the
+ * <code>PipedReader</code> to which this object is connected has
+ * a buffer that cannot hold all of the chars to be written.
+ *
+ * @param buffer The array containing chars to write to the stream.
+ * @param offset The index into the array to start writing chars from.
+ * @param len The number of chars to write.
+ *
+ * @exception IOException If the stream has not been connected or has
+ * been closed.
+ */
+ public void write(char[] buffer, int offset, int len) throws IOException
+ {
+ if (sink == null)
+ throw new IOException ("Not connected");
+ if (closed)
+ throw new IOException ("Pipe closed");
+
+ sink.receive(buffer, offset, len);
+ }
+
+ /**
+ * This method does nothing.
+ *
+ * @exception IOException If the stream is closed.
+ * @specnote You'd think that this method would block until the sink
+ * had read all available data. Thats not the case - this method
+ * appears to be a no-op?
+ */
+ public void flush() throws IOException
+ {
+ if (closed)
+ throw new IOException ("Pipe closed");
+ }
+
+ /**
+ * This method closes this stream so that no more data can be written
+ * to it. Any further attempts to write to this stream may throw an
+ * exception
+ *
+ * @exception IOException If an error occurs
+ */
+ public void close() throws IOException
+ {
+ // A close call on an unconnected PipedWriter has no effect.
+ if (sink != null)
+ {
+ closed = true;
+ // Notify any waiting readers that the stream is now closed.
+ synchronized (sink)
+ {
+ sink.notifyAll();
+ }
+ }
+ }
+}
